You can tell from the distinct shortage of leafy greens in the box that we are deep in the throes of summer heat. Thankfully our friends at Bluebonnet Hydroponics are growing beautiful lettuce indoors so that we can have some leaves in our meal plan! This heat isn’t all bad, though. It’s making for some ultra-sweet peaches, juicy melons, and awesome okra. Here’s what I’m making with the bounty:
Meal one: Those peaches are ripe and ready to eat, so I’ll be using them all up in this first meal of the week. No recipe here, just a simple salad of lettuce, sliced peaches, tomato wedges, sliced red onion, and Chevre. I’ll top the whole thing with some toasted pecans and balsamic vinaigrette dressing.
Meal two: A Local Box with okras, tomatoes, peppers, and onions? Must be time for stewed okra and tomatoes! This one-dish meal is beyond easy to prepare, and tasted great with pita bread on the side.
Meal three: There’s nothing wrong with eating dessert first, especially if it’s baked pears with goat cheese. For an entree, I will serve baked chicken and onions along with sliced cantaloupe on the side.
Bonus: if there’s extra cantaloupe and pears or peaches, I want to use those to experiment with smoothies. These hardly need a recipe– just combine one part yogurt (or ice and soymilk) in a blender with one part chopped fruit. Yum!
